  • Hi Foodies! This recipe is for all my foodies who love spice or just want a little spice in their life. This recipe is a quick and easy Jamaican hot pickled pepper (escovitch pickle sauce). The amazing thing about this is after a day in the refrigerator it is ready to be used. The longer you keep the more developed the flavours become. This pickle pepper is rich in flavours; spicy, sweet, and tangy. Add it to your stew, soup, stir-fry, sandwich, etc.
